A Strategic Move with the Tempo Brand

Let’s dive into Hilton Hotels’ latest power move – launching Tempo by Hilton in Belfast, Northern Ireland. This isn’t just another hotel opening; it’s Hilton planting its flag firmly on European soil with a brand that’s been making waves stateside. Why is this such a big deal? For starters, Tempo by Hilton is not your average hotel. It’s what the industry calls a ’lifestyle hotel’, designed for what they term ’modern achievers’. Think well-being, think sustainability, think high-tech – that’s Tempo.

So, why Belfast? Well, it’s clear Hilton has been paying attention to market trends. Northern Ireland’s tourism is booming, thanks in part to its rich heritage and, let’s be honest, a little show called Game of Thrones. By choosing Belfast for its European debut of the Tempo brand, Hilton is making a statement: they’re ready to cater to the sophisticated, wellness-focused traveler on both sides of the Atlantic.

What’s the Big Deal About Belfast?

The significance of Tempo by Hilton’s opening in Belfast goes beyond just a new lodging option. It’s about bringing a fresh concept to a city (and continent) where traditional hotels have dominated. This move could potentially shift consumer expectations and set a new standard for what a hotel experience can be. What’s more, with over 50 additional sites in the pipeline, including anticipated openings in San Diego, California, and Tennessee, Tempo’s aggressive expansion strategy is clear. But its Belfast debut marks a significant step in Hilton’s broader ambition to reshape the hotel landscape.

And let’s not overlook the timing. Opening the first European Tempo in the same breath as Hilton celebrates its 1,000th hotel in the EMEA region is no small feat. It underscores the company’s rapid growth and its commitment to innovation and expansion. This isn’t just about adding numbers; it’s about Hilton diversifying its portfolio and tapping into new markets with precision.
